A group of proteins produced by white blood cells, fibroblasts, and T-cells in response to viral infections, bacteria, tumor cells, and other pathogens are known as interferons. These glycoproteins, also known as cytokines, are frequently referred to as the first line of defense against pathogens.
Get a holistic overview of the market from industry experts to evaluate and develop growth strategies. Download the sample @ https://www.futuremarketinsights.com/reports/sample/rep-gb-15158
Interferons have proved to be a cutting-edge and successful treatment option for illnesses such as cancer, hepatitis, and multiple sclerosis. In November 2021, for instance, the FDA approved BESREMi for the treatment of adults living with polycythemia vera, which is a recent advancement in the interferons industry.
Polycythemia vera is a group of rare, chronic, and life-threatening blood cancers caused by a mutation in bone marrow stem cells, which further leads to an abundance of blood cells. When this happens, a person is at high risk of significant health problems such as blood clots, strokes, and heart attacks.

Surgical booms are also known as Equipment Management Systems (EMS). Surgical booms are used to constrain electrical wiring from the various equipment used in the OR. They also help organise the space in the OR by increasing the working space. Most surgical booms are suspended from the roof of the OR and are available in a number of designs and utilities.

Increase in the Adoption of Minimally Invasive Surgeries is Likely to Drive the Growth of the Surgical Booms Market
Minimally Invasive Surgery (MIS) is one of the major trends in medicine. MIS is a safe, feasible, and patient-friendly method of performing medical procedures such as surgery. MIS offers reduced postoperative pain, shorter length of stay in a hospital, lesser scarring or damage to tissues, and generally leads to faster recovery. Hence, MIS is easier and less time-consuming. As clinicians seek safer and more efficient ways to perform surgery, they find new applications for minimally invasive procedures, because the benefits of the same for patients are paramount.
Furthermore, the increasing number of insurance providers that offer reimbursement for costs incurred during most minimally invasive procedures is expected to increase the adoption rate of minimally invasive surgeries. The Centers for Medicare and Medicaid Services (CMS) provides reimbursement for peripheral access procedures, such as the insertion of a port or catheter into a large central artery that is directly related to or is near the heart. Thus, increase in the number of minimally invasive surgeries is boosting the demand for equipment management systems such as equipment booms.

High Capital Investment for Integrated OR to Hinder the Growth of Surgical Booms Market
Integrated ORs utilise a crossover of medical interventions to form hybrid technologies. The development and integration of ORs requires the re-organization of professionals. In addition, there is a need to upgrade the capital equipment. Cost of such advanced capital equipment is high. Furthermore, compatibility with existing or new devices/infrastructure is likely to present a hurdle for the designers, manufacturers, and end users of surgical booms.
A hybrid OR, on an average, requires 50-80% more space as compared to a conventional OR in the U.S., and 30-40% more in Germany. The additional space required is another factor that is likely to increase the cost of the setup of an integrated OR. Thus, the capital cost required for an integrated OR is likely to hinder the growth of the surgical booms market.

The vestibular testing system is a sensory system that controls special orientation and coordination. Vestibular testing system consists of a number of tests.
The market for vestibular testing systems will reportedly be worth US$113.9 million in 2022. The vestibular testing system market is expected to expand at a sluggish CAGR of 5% and reach US$ 195.1 million by 2032.
These tests helps in determining whether or not there is something wrong with the vestibular portion of the inner ear. Moreover, these tests can help in isolating dizziness symptoms which can later be treated.
Download FREE Sample Copy of Report @ https://www.futuremarketinsights.com/reports/sample/rep-gb-5048
Vestibular testing systems are used to diagnose patients suffering from balance problems. However, many recent studies have analyzed that vestibular testing systems are more accurate than medical examination in identifying inner ear disorders.
Tests for hearing evaluations are categorized into audiometric hearing evaluation, videonystagmography (VNG), vestibular evoked myogenic potential (VEMP), rotary chair and computerized dynamic posturography.
The tests include hearing evaluations because the balance and hearing functions of the inner ear are closely related.
The vestibular tests are suggested for those people who are mainly suffering from vertigo, balance disorders, disequilibrium, benign paroxysmal positional vertigo (BPPV) and concussion.
The main objective of the vestibular testing system is to decrease the symptoms of vertigo & dizziness, improve gaze stability and decrease risk of falls.
According to the CDC, more than one third of adults of age 65 and older fall each year in the United States and about 20% to 30% of people who fall suffer moderate to severe injuries.

Growing Popularity of Single-incision Laparoscopic Surgery
Single-site incisional surgery is being widely used in laparoscopic procedures and is replacing traditional method of laparoscopic procedures, in which four to five small incisions were made as the entry point for laparoscopic instruments. Some of the key benefits of single-site incision laparoscopic procedure over traditional procedure are low chances of infections, better cosmetic results, quick recovery and less post-operative pain.
According to Journal of the Society of Laparoendoscopic Surgeons (JSLS), women who undergo single-site incision laparoscopic surgery tend to report lesser post-operative pain compared to traditional method laparoscopic surgery. Growing demand for single-incision laparoscopic surgeries would thus drive the growth of laparoscopic devices market.
Adoption of Subscription Commerce Marketing Model
Companies are adopting various marketing model schemes such as subscription commerce to boost the sale of laparoscopic devices. Under this scheme, companies provide medical devices such as laparoscopy devices on pay-per-use basis. Thus, various end use segments can have access to these devices which might otherwise be prohibitively expensive, which in turn is helping manufacturers to expand their market share for laparoscopic devices, globally.
